[QUOTE="Codragon, post: 184375, member: 1924"] [b]well[/b] Hello Eternalknight, I think this is a great thread. I've loved the Lone Wolf books and been engrossed in them more than ANY fantasy author. The conversions to D&D stats are well-done! However...I think its damn near impossible to create a Kai Lord base class that is balances with the existing D&D classes. Who would want to be a fighter when you could be a Kai Lord? Don't forget, the aptly titled Lone Wolf books are about solo adventuring. You (the Kai Lord) are able to fight, cast spells, cure yourself, use psionics and have a whole slew of skills. I don't think a prestige class fits the bill either.. A solution: to heck with D&D! Use the d20 system! What I mean is come up with a whole new set of base classes that balance with each other. Sorta like the Wheel of Time RPG book. We could even keep the existing classes. We then have three "tiers" of classes, as follows: [B]Lone Wolf Classes[/B] Kai Lord Herbwarden Member of Crystal Star Brotherhood Elder Mage Warrior-Magician of Dessi (whatever Paido was) etc? [B]PH Classes[/B] (as PH, maybe not all) [B]NPC Classes[/B] (as DMG) What do you guys think? I just don't think its entirely fair to keep "powering-down" the Kai Lord to make him balanced with existing D&D classes. Making a whole new class system requires a lot of thought though. We could also change the Magic system to be more like Grey Star... [/QUOTE]
